WebJun 1, 2005 · Pump/motor relays on integral ABS systems are external to the unit while some non-integral ABS systems incorporate the relay into the ECU, as shown in Figure 13. This arrangement increases repair costs because a failed $20 dollar relay will require the entire ECU or EHCU to be replaced. WebJun 2, 2024 · 1.9's used to have problems with the combined ABS pump and ECU under the bonnet, the 896/897 ASC unit. The ABS pump was 896, the plastic ECU 897. They're shared with various E36 four cylinder cars and some earlier E46 316i/318i. You'll pay 50 quid for one, they're everywhere.
